CL draw: Juventus net Bayern Munich
Juventus will have to get past German giants Bayern Munich in the last eight if their Champions League adventure is to continue.
The Old Lady went into today’s Nyon draw primarily looking to avoid three sides – Barcelona, Real Madrid and Bayern Munich.
However, Bayern and Juventus were the last two teams out of the hat. The first leg will take place in Germany, with the return set for the Juventus Stadium.
Bayern came through the last 16 by beating Arsenal on the away goals rule, while Juve smashed five past Celtic.
Elsewhere, Real Madrid and Borussia Dortmund were handed ‘kind’ ties against Galatasaray and Malaga respectively.
Barcelona, conquerors of Milan in the last round, will face a Paris Saint-Germain outfit bossed by former Diavolo tactician Carlo Ancelotti.
That tie will also see PSG’s Zlatan Ibrahimovic come up against his former side.
The first leg games are set to be played on April 2 and 3 and second leg ties are scheduled for April 9 and 10.
Quarter-final draw: Malaga-Borussia Dortmund [Apr 3 and 9]; Real Madrid-Galatasaray [Apr 3 and 9]; Paris Saint-Germain-Barcelona [Apr 2 and 10]; Bayern-Munich-Juventus [Apr 2 and 10].
